Stars team yet to be paid months after India trip

Harambee Stars starting eleven in a previous match [COURTESY]

Football Kenya Federation has not paid Harambee Stars players, who took part in the 2018 Intercontinental Cup tournament held in India their dues from the Sh2.5 million prize money awarded for emerging the first runner-up. Kenya had a comprehensive squad of 21 players at the tournament held between June 1 and 10.

One of the players explained to The Nairobian that the agreement was that the federation gets half of the Sh2.5 million and the other half was to be shared amongst the players. This means every player was to receive about Sh119,000. But three months down the line, no payment has been made.
